Yeah, I know, I sound like a Smartgit fanboi. We pay for our licenses and have just renewed for the year ahead – that’s because they produce updates with improved and extended functionality all the time. I like their support and find them a really approachable company. I’ve used Big Company CM tools from the likes of IBM and others, but make no mistake, Smartgit is the best I’ve used in years. I’ve no connection to Syntevo other than being a customer. My user base covers 50+ people across 3 different countries and skill levels from HW engineers to expert SW devs On windows, the OS seems to capitalise the initial and first character of the surname eg PSmith instead of psmith, which *may* cause some grief for you if you use SSH to pull repos with submodulesīut for 99% of our CM needs, it’s a fantastic UI that’s super easy to train people to use. Rebasing seems a bit more complicated than it needs to be (i.e. There are some occasions where there’s room for improvement ![]() ![]() though it looks the prettiest on my Mac – doesn’t everything? Piping the output through less is advisable, theres going to be quite a bit of it. To have ps search through all of the processes use the. The ps command can be used to find the PID of a process. Want to cherry pick a commit from one branch to your current activity? Easy.Įxactly the same interface on Linux, Windows and OSX. To use kill, you must know the process ID (PID) of the process you wish to terminate. ![]() I’m quite happy using the CLI for git and script a ton of auto-git scripts, but from a user perspective, it makes doing the day-to-day CM activities super-easy and really intuitive. Smartgit is a brilliant interface for git. When cloning smartgit still asks me for http authentication. And I use, create and maintain *a lot* of repos. In my experience with Smartgit, it has never broken a repo either locally or remotely.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|